Directions for "I AM" Poem Project: Due -- Your block day Sept. 22 or 23
With your partner, write a poem about your geographic feature using personification.
Create a “Geo Person” using the human -bodypattern, but you may modify the shape any way you want.
Choose the BIG construction paper size as your background.
Use the “I AM” poem template found on the wiki to type out your poem. You will print out the poem and then cut out separately the three stanzas. Then paste the three stanzas around your “geo person.”
You may draw or print out pictures about your topic and then cut and paste onto your project.
Color or decorate your “geo person.”
You MUST include a TITLE and a MAP that shows where your topic is located. Format it so it is small and will fit on the project.
Place your name on the back.
